Almond Blossom Festival is back

The event program will be available from January 3

Pedestrian walks, shows, street market, gastronomic workshops and much more. It is the “Festival of the Almond Trees in Blossom” that returns from the 3rd to the 5th of February to Alta Mora (Castro Marim).

The program is not closed yet, but there are already some differences compared to the first edition of this festival.

In addition to having one more day, there will be more pedestrian walks, new shows, a wider street market and artisan village, as well as a space dedicated to traditional agriculture and forestry. There will also be gastronomic workshops and almond tree planting workshops.

«The Almond Tree Festival is a strategic initiative to promote and revitalize the values, traditions and identity of the territory, with the main objective of combating desertification and the rampant depopulation of the interior of the Algarve mountains. Thus, the second edition intends to assert itself as one of the great cultural events that marks the tourist route of the region in the middle of the low season», says the Associação Recreativa, Cultural e Desportiva dos Amigos da Alta Mora

Without the support of 365Algarve, the 2023 edition takes place without co-financing but with the support and partnership of the Municipality of Castro Marim and the collaboration of several other entities and institutions: Parish Council of Odeleite, Associação Odiana, Associação In Loco, Associação Artística Satori , Association for the Defense, Rehabilitation, Research and Promotion of the Natural and Cultural Heritage of Cacela (ADRIP), the Center for Culture and Sports for the Staff of the Castro Marim City Council, the Hotel and Tourism School of Vila Real de Santo António and the Refood from VRSA.
